Wacana Kritis Rencana Pembangunan PLTN di Bangka

Muhammad Adha Al Kodri, Sunyoto Usman

2014 | Tesis | Sosiologi

ABSTRACT This research aims to understand the discourse of construction plan for nuclear power plant in Bangka Daily Post and Babel Post from January 2011 to September 2014. This discourse can be divided into three dimensions such as technical dimension (related to high technology, security concept, independence, and competition between countries), economic dimension (efficiency), and sociocultural dimension (related to the accuracy, safety, distrust for authority, aspects of technology transfer, and social perception). The research is very important because it can reveal the treasury of knowledge, awareness and attitude about the benefits and disadvantages of nuclear power plant development. It used descriptive qualitative method with content analysis technique. Developed conceptual framework for understanding the discourse referenced to the view of Teun Van Dijk on the text and social analysis. The results of this research indicate that there are different discourses between those who support and oppose the plan of nuclear power plant. The pro parties claim that construction of nuclear power plant using green building concept can maintain and create a healthy environment for the community, using security guarantee concept can be used in agriculture and health, and is considered as a form of energy independence. Nuclear power plant also has smaller-scale waste and more efficient economically, and support the application of sustainable development concept. While those who oppose assume that radiation and radioactive waste of nuclear power plant is very dangerous for human safety and the environment. Nuclear power plant is only considered as a government project that is prone to collusion and corruption. The parties also do not believe there will be transfer of technology because technology, development process, operation and maintenance are still dominated by experts and practitioners from manufacture countries of nuclear power plant technology. The issue of nuclear power plant development is still quite sensitive, including in the local level. Through the use of coherence differentiator elements, Bangka Post news are presented more balanced than Babel Post. Pro parties dominate mass media to limit the production and negative discourse construction of nuclear power plant. The plan gives stimulant on the public distrust and trigger disharmony relationship between local government and the community. Many local government officials support the discourse of nuclear power plant construction, but the developed discourse among local communities tends to reject it.
